36 Atherton End, Sawbridgeworth, CM21 0BS is a freehold terraced property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 592 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£323,175 , which equates to approximately £546 per square foot. It was last sold on 26 Apr 2007 for £184,000. Since then, the value has increased by £139,175, representing a 75.6% increase, or approximately 4.1% per year.

36 Atherton End, Sawbridgeworth, East Hertfordshire, Hertfordshire, CM21 0BS has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 25 Jan 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 18 Oct 2012.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 8.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of energy efficiency changing from poor to very poor, with the construction or insulation remaining pitched, limited insulation (assumed).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, partial ins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 50%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
